Docker
容器核心技术Cgroups和Namespace
关于chroot、namespace和cgroups简单描述如下。
共找到 28 篇相关文章
关于chroot、namespace和cgroups简单描述如下。
LXC(Linux Containers)。
容器类似于虚拟化,但和虚拟化有本质区别。
容器就像是一个小型的虚拟环境,类似于一个盒子,里面包含了一个应用程序及其所有需要的东西,比如代码、库、配置文件等等。这个盒子可以在不同的计算机上运行,而无需担心计算机的操作系统或其他设置。
镜像体积会直接影响构建速度、传输成本和容器启动效率。本文围绕 Docker 镜像优化的常见做法展开,先解释为什么需要控制体积,再演示 Alpine 基础镜像和多阶段构建的落地方式。
Dockerfile 是把应用打包成镜像的核心描述文件。本文先概览常见指令,再通过创建用户、环境变量、启动命令、文件复制和构建传参等示例,帮助你建立 Dockerfile 编写思路。
掌握 Docker 常用命令,才能把镜像管理、容器运行和日常排障串起来。本文按镜像仓库、容器维护和构建检查三个方向整理 Docker 高频命令,适合作为入门操作清单。
Docker 是理解容器化交付和 Kubernetes 的基础。本文先梳理 Docker 的核心概念与组成,再以 CentOS 7 为例整理常见安装步骤,帮助你快速完成入门环境准备。